The Huddersfield Weekly is a tabloid newspaper distributed in the town of Huddersfield and other towns and villages in the west Yorkshire metropolitan borough of Kirklees, including Holmfirth, Kirkburton, Meltham, Marsden. The newspaper publishes local, national, international, sports and entertainment news. The newspaper is published by Examiner News & Info Services Ltd and it comes out on Thursdays.

About Huddersfield
Huddersfield is a large market town of Metropolitan Borough of Kirklees, in the west Yorkshire, England. It is located 190 miles north to London and 10.3 miles south of Bradford. The town is surrounded by historic county boundaries of the West Riding of Yorkshire, The town has an estimated population of 146,234 and it was the 10th largest town in the United Kingdom as of 2001. The town is best known for its role in the industrial revolution and it is also the birthplace of rugby league team Huddersfield Giants, founded in 1895, who currently play in the European Super League.
